This Complex Connection: Allergy-Related Rhinitis, Bronchial Asthma, and Sinusitis

A surprisingly prevalent phenomenon in clinical practice involves the intertwined nature of allergic rhinitis, bronchial asthma, and sinusitis. Frequently, these three conditions, while distinct in their primary site of impact, are not isolated incidents. Allergic rhinitis, involving nasal congestion, runny nose, and itching, frequently coexists with bronchial asthma, a chronic respiratory disease that causes wheezing. Furthermore, the ongoing inflammation associated with allergic rhinitis can exacerbate sinusitis, an inflammation of the paranasal cavities. The shared trigger – typically allergens like pollen, dust mites, or pet dander – can drive inflammation in all three areas, suggesting a unified immune reaction. Understanding this relationship is vital for effective assessment and treatment of patients experiencing these related conditions, aiming for a comprehensive and complete approach.

Respiratory Condition Range: Seasonal Nasal Allergy, Asthma, and Sinus Infection

A significant group of individuals experience a connected spectrum of respiratory ailments, frequently involving inflammatory rhinitis, bronchial disease, and sinusitis. Allergic rhinitis, often triggered by dust mites, manifests as nasal congestion, runny nose, and irritated eyes. This condition can frequently be present alongside with asthma, a chronic inflammatory airway disease characterized by difficulty breathing, restricted airflow, and chest tightness. Furthermore, inflammation in the nasal passages due to irritants can contribute to sinusitis, an inflammation of the air-filled spaces which is usually due to a viral or bacterial contamination. Recognizing the interplay between these common conditions is important for successful diagnosis and treatment.
